Suspects arrested in Hamden breaking and entering
Two men were arrested on May 17 after an investigation into the breaking and entering of a Hamden building.
Robert Wright, 18, and Trevor Lee, 20, both of Hamden, were arrested on Wilson Avenue in Hamden, according to Vinton County Sheriff Shawn Justice.
An investigation into the breaking and entering of a building owned by Joyce Seymour of South Church Street in Hamden led to the arrest of the two suspects.
The investigation was conducted by Deputy Pennie McCune and Deputy Destanny Couch with assistance from Deputy Ethan Doerr and Ohio State Highway Patrol Trooper Bert Wilson.
Both men were charged with breaking and theft and are being held at Southeastern Ohio Regional Jail.
Other charges relating to several car break-ins will be presented to the prosecuting attorney for further review, according to Justice.
